Our Belief

We believe in one God, the Father, eternally existing, who is a Spirit, a personal Being of supreme intelligence, knowledge, love, justice, power and authority. He, through Jesus Christ, is the Creator of the heavens and the earth and all that is in them.

He is the Source of life and the One for whom (hu)man life exists. We believe in one Lord, Jesus Christ of Nazareth, who is the Word and who has eternally existed. We believe that He is the Messiah, the Christ, the divine Son of the living God, conceived of the Holy Spirit, born in (hu)man flesh of the virgin Mary.

We believe that it is by Him that God created all things, and that without Him was not anything made that was made. We believe in the Holy Spirit as the Spirit of God and of Christ. The Holy Spirit is the power of God and the Spirit of life eternal

We believe that Scripture, both the Old and New Testament, is God’s revelation and His complete expressed will to (hu)manity. Scripture is inspired in thought and word, infallible in the original writings; is the supreme and final authority in faith and in life; and is the foundation of all truth.

We believe that Satan is a spirit being who is the adversary of God and the children of God; Satan has been given dominion over the world for a specific time; Satan has deceived (hu)manity into rejecting God and His law; Satan has ruled by deception with the aid of a host of demons who are followers of Satan

We believe that (hu)man’s where created in the image of God with the potential to become children of God, partakers of the divine nature. God formed (hu)man of flesh, which is material substance. (hu)man beings live by the breath of life, are mortal, subject to corruption and decay, without eternal life, except as the gift of God under God’s terms and conditions as expressed in the Bible. We believe that God placed before Adam and Eve the choice of eternal life through obedience to God or death through sin. Adam and Eve yielded to temptation and disobeyed God. As a result, sin entered the world, and, through sin, death. Death now reigns over all (hu)manity because all have sinned

We believe that sin is the transgression of the law. The law is spiritual, perfect, holy, just and good. The law defines God’s love and is based upon the two great principles of love toward God and love toward neighbor. It is immutable and binding. The Ten Commandments are the 10 points of God’s law of love. We believe that breaking any one point of the law brings upon a person the penalty of sin. We believe that this fundamental spiritual law reveals the only way to true life and the only possible way of happiness, peace and joy. All unhappiness, misery, anguish and woe have come from transgressing God’s law.

We believe God so loved the world of helpless sinners that He gave His only begotten Son, who, though in all points tempted as we are, lived without sin in the (hu)man flesh. That Son, Jesus Christ, died as a sacrifice for the sins of (hu)man’s. His life, because He is the creator of all (hu)man’s, is of greater value than the sum total of all (hu)man life. His death is, therefore, sufficient to pay the penalty for every (hu)man being’s sins. In paying this penalty He has made it possible, according to God’s plan for each person to have their sins forgiven and to be released from the death penalty

We believe that the Father raised Jesus Christ from the dead after His body lay three days and three nights in the grave, thus making immortality possible for mortal man. He thereafter ascended into heaven, where He now sits at the right hand of God the Father as our High Priest and Advocate

We believe in God’s enduring righteousness. That righteousness is demonstrated by God’s faithfulness in fulfilling all the promises He made to the father of the faithful, Abraham. As promised, God multiplied Abraham’s lineal descendants so that Abraham literally became the “father” of many nations. We believe that God, as promised, materially prospered Abraham’s lineal descendants Isaac and Jacob (whose name He later changed to Israel). We believe that God, through Abraham’s Seed, Jesus Christ, is making salvation available to all (hu)manity. We believe that the knowledge that God has fulfilled and continues to fulfill the physical promises made to Abraham and his children, and that He is fulfilling the spiritual promise through Jesus Christ, is critical to understanding the message of the prophets and its application to the world.

We believe God’s purpose for mankind is to prepare those whom He calls—and who elect through a life of overcoming sin, developing righteous character and growing in grace and knowledge—to possess God’s Kingdom and become kings and priests reigning with Christ at His return. We believe that the reason for mankind’s existence is literally to be born as spirit beings into the family of God.

We believe in the personal, visible, pre-millennial return of the Lord Jesus Christ to rule the nations on earth as King of Kings and to continue His priestly office as Lord of Lords. At that time, He will sit upon the throne of David. During His 1,000-year reign on the earth, He will restore all things and establish the Kingdom of God forever.

We believe in the ordinance of water baptism by immersion after repentance. Through the laying on of hands, with prayer,the believer receives the Holy Spirit and becomes a part of the
spiritual Body of Jesus Christ

We believe that the seventh day of the week is the Sabbath of the Lord our God. On this day we are commanded to rest from our labors and worship God.
